Galvanized Pipe Corrosion and Flow Restriction
Many properties in Kaysville, especially in older established neighborhoods near the city center and along mature tree-lined streets, carry galvanized steel supply lines that have narrowed significantly from interior mineral buildup. This leads to reduced water pressure at fixtures and accelerated corrosion at threaded joints, putting supply reliability and subfloor materials at risk.
Local professionals correct galvanized pipe issues with targeted section replacement, copper or PEX transitions, and joint resealing, preventing long-term damage to surrounding framing and finishes.
Clay Soil Movement and Drain Line Displacement
Kaysville's soil composition in many residential zones includes expansive clay layers that shift with moisture fluctuation. Seasonal saturation followed by dry periods causes lateral drain lines to settle unevenly, which can lead to low spots that collect debris and partial blockages that worsen with each freeze-thaw cycle.
Professionals manage these conditions with camera-assisted line inspection, precision pipe realignment, and trenchless repair methods, adapted to existing landscaping and utility corridors.
Aging Septic Systems in Outlying Residential Zones
Years of continuous use without scheduled maintenance have left many Kaysville septic systems struggling to process waste at design capacity. Tank compartments accumulate solids faster than expected when inlet baffles degrade, and drain fields lose absorption efficiency when compacted by surface traffic.
Local pros revitalize these systems through septic tank cleaning, baffle inspection and replacement, and drain field evaluation, enhancing system longevity and protecting yard drainage.
Freeze-Thaw Stress on Exterior and Crawlspace Pipe Runs
Winter temperatures across the Kaysville area bring sustained hard freezes that stress exposed pipe runs along exterior walls and in unconditioned crawlspaces. Repeated freeze-thaw cycles cause micro-fractures at fittings and solder joints that expand into active leaks once temperatures rise.
Experienced crews install pipe insulation wrap and heat tape using proper overlap technique, secure fastening, and thermostat-controlled activation, ensuring continuous flow even under extended below-freezing conditions common along the Wasatch Front.
Tight Crawlspace Access and Retrofit Complexity
Shallow crawlspaces are common in Kaysville ranch-style homes, making drain line access and pipe replacement considerably harder than in properties with full basement clearance.
Local pros use articulated inspection cameras and low-profile cutting tools, prioritizing minimal disruption to vapor barriers and insulation to deliver plumbing repairs that fit every property without unnecessary structural impact.
